:root{--ink: #1A1612;--paper: #F5F0E8;--surface: #FFFFFF;--accent: #C8302E;--line: #2A2520;--line-paper: #E5DED1;--ink-muted: #6B5F52;--paper-muted: rgba(245, 240, 232, .65);--ink-faint: #9C9285;--surface-card: #EFEBE2;--font-display: "Jost", sans-serif;--font-body: "Fraunces", serif;--fs-display: clamp(36px, 5.5vw, 72px);--fs-h1: 40px;--fs-h2: 28px;--fs-h3: 20px;--fs-body: 16px;--fs-small: 13px;--space-1: 8px;--space-2: 16px;--space-3: 24px;--space-4: 32px;--space-5: 48px;--space-6: 64px;--space-7: 96px;--space-8: 128px;--section-gap: 96px;--section-gap-mobile: 56px;--container-max: 1280px;--gutter: 24px;--gutter-mobile: 16px;--header-height: 64px;--announcement-bar-height: 32px}[x-cloak]{display:none!important}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}html{font-size:16px;-webkit-text-size-adjust:100%}body{font-family:var(--font-body);font-size:var(--fs-body);line-height:1.6;color:var(--ink);background-color:var(--paper);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}img,video,svg{display:block;max-width:100%;height:auto}a{color:inherit;text-decoration:none}ul,ol{list-style:none}button{cursor:pointer;border:none;background:none;font:inherit}input,textarea,select{font:inherit}h1,h2,h3,h4,h5,h6{font-family:var(--font-display);font-weight:900;line-height:1.15;color:var(--ink)}h1{font-size:var(--fs-h1)}h2{font-size:var(--fs-h2)}h3{font-size:var(--fs-h3);font-family:var(--font-body);font-weight:600}p{font-family:var(--font-body);font-size:var(--fs-body);line-height:1.6;max-width:65ch}.eyebrow{font-family:var(--font-display);font-size:var(--fs-small);font-weight:500;letter-spacing:.08em;text-transform:uppercase;color:var(--ink-muted)}.container{max-width:var(--container-max);margin-left:auto;margin-right:auto;padding-left:var(--gutter);padding-right:var(--gutter)}@media(max-width:767px){.container{padding-left:var(--gutter-mobile);padding-right:var(--gutter-mobile)}}.btn{display:inline-flex;align-items:center;justify-content:center;font-family:var(--font-display);font-size:var(--fs-small);font-weight:500;letter-spacing:.06em;text-transform:uppercase;padding:12px 24px;border-radius:4px;transition:opacity .15s ease,background-color .15s ease;cursor:pointer;border:none;text-decoration:none}.btn--primary{background-color:var(--accent);color:var(--surface)}.btn--primary:hover{opacity:.88}.btn--secondary-dark{background-color:var(--ink);color:var(--paper)}.btn--secondary-dark:hover{opacity:.85}.btn--outline-paper{background-color:transparent;color:var(--paper);border:1px solid var(--paper)}.btn--outline-paper:hover{background-color:var(--paper);color:var(--ink)}.visually-hidden{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}:focus-visible{outline:2px solid var(--accent);outline-offset:2px}body{padding-top:var(--header-height)}body.announcement-bar-active{padding-top:calc(var(--header-height) + var(--announcement-bar-height))}.free-shipping-line{display:inline-block;color:var(--accent);font-size:var(--fs-small);font-family:var(--font-display)}.free-shipping-line--earned{color:var(--accent);font-weight:600}.shopify-policy__container{max-width:720px;margin:0 auto;padding:80px var(--gutter)}.shopify-policy__title h1{font-family:var(--font-display);font-weight:900;font-size:var(--fs-h1);line-height:1.1;color:var(--ink);margin-bottom:40px}.shopify-policy__body{font-family:var(--font-body);font-size:var(--fs-body);color:var(--ink);line-height:1.6}.shopify-policy__body p{margin-bottom:16px;max-width:none}.shopify-policy__body h2{font-family:var(--font-display);font-size:var(--fs-h2);font-weight:900;color:var(--ink);margin-top:40px;margin-bottom:16px}.shopify-policy__body h3{font-family:var(--font-display);font-size:var(--fs-h3);font-weight:700;color:var(--ink);margin-top:28px;margin-bottom:12px}.shopify-policy__body ul,.shopify-policy__body ol{list-style:disc;padding-left:24px;margin-bottom:16px}.shopify-policy__body ol{list-style:decimal}.shopify-policy__body li{font-family:var(--font-body);font-size:var(--fs-body);color:var(--ink);line-height:1.6;margin-bottom:6px}.shopify-policy__body a{color:var(--accent);text-decoration:underline}.shopify-policy__body strong{font-weight:600}@media(max-width:767px){.shopify-policy__container{padding:48px var(--gutter-mobile)}.shopify-policy__title h1{font-size:32px}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/theme.css.map */
